Boost for initiative to help people be more active
A coalition of organisations led by Community Action Derby aimed at getting people more active is to benefit from a community scheme launched by a leisure operator.
Everyone Active, which runs Moorways Sports Village in partnership with Derby City Council, launched Community Champions last year to support projects which are tackling local issues and changing lives.
The successful applicant in Derby this year is DE23 Active, a coalition of community organisations led by Community Action Derby, with the mission of helping people in Normanton and Arboretum get active.

As a result, DE23 Active will secure valuable use of facilities within Moorways Sports Village, to help it carry out its work.
Helen Britten, programme lead at Community Action Derby, said: “We’re delighted that DE23 Active has been selected as an Everyone Active Community Champion.
“This support will help us continue providing opportunities that make it easier for people in Normanton and Arboretum to get active in ways that work for them.
“Working closely with residents and our partner organisations, we’ve developed activities that respond to the needs of the community, including our popular women-only swimming sessions at Moorways Sports Village.
“We’re looking forward to building on that success and helping even more people enjoy the benefits of being active.”
